Stainless steel 347H fasteners are designed to operate at elevated temperatures and offer excellent resistance against corrosion in abnormal hostile conditions. Austenitic stainless steels contain niobium and tantalum carbon additions in a solid solution.
The composition of stainless steel 347H fasteners is crucial for understanding their properties and performance in various industrial applications.
Grade | Mn | N | P | C | S | Cr | Mo | Si | Ni | Other | |
347H | min. max | 2.00 | - | 0.045 | 0.04 0.10 | 0.030 | 17.0 19.0 | 3 – 4 | 0.75 | 9.00 13.00 | - - |

Density | Melting Point | Tensile Strength |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) | Elongation |
8.0 g/cm3 | 1454 °C (2650 °F) | Psi – 75000 , MPa – 515 | Psi – 30000 , MPa – 205 | 35 % |
